Ir para conteúdo
View in the app

A better way to browse. Learn more.

Portal do Host

A full-screen app on your home screen with push notifications, badges and more.

To install this app on iOS and iPadOS
  1. Tap the Share icon in Safari
  2. Scroll the menu and tap Add to Home Screen.
  3. Tap Add in the top-right corner.
To install this app on Android
  1. Tap the 3-dot menu (⋮) in the top-right corner of the browser.
  2. Tap Add to Home screen or Install app.
  3. Confirm by tapping Install.

Desenvolvi um Modulo que calcula estimativa de lucros futuros (e passados)

Featured Replies

Postado

Olá pessoal, tudo bem?

Estava a procura de um módulo para WHMCS que pudesse me dar uma previsão de lucros com base nos custos mensais com a manutenção do servidor (Locação de Servidor, Licença de cPanel, Módulos, Plugins de Backup, etc). Achei um chamado Expense Tracker, mas é caro e com muitos recursos que não via necessidade. A ideia era apenas lançar uma previsão mensal de custos que o servidor possui e ele criar uma previsão de lucro.

Consegui desenvolver meu próprio modulo, gostei do resultado e compartilho com o pessoal aqui. A ideia é criar uma previsão mensal de custos para cada coisa (ex: se pagou R$ 2.000 num servidor por 24 meses, lance R$ 83,33 lá, o que corresponde ao valor de custo mensal). O próprio sistema pega todas estimativas futuras de entradas e cria uma tabela, e gera um gráfico. Também inclui um campo para exclusões: você seleciona produtos que não devem ser levados em conta na hora de considerar as entradas. A ideia é que às vezes faturamos no WHMCS alguns serviços que não tem a ver com a hospedagem em sí (ex: serviços avulsos, ou qualquer outra coisa que você esteja faturando no WHMCS mas não tenha a ver com a sua hospedagem). Então basta selecionar todas as categorias que não devem entrar no relatório e salvar. Gerei umas faturas de teste e testei tudo, funcionou muito bem, devo colocar em produção agora. Vou mandar uns prints de como ficou:

image.png

image.png

image.png

Aí aproveitei e resolvi usar a mesma lógica para entradas passadas. Neste caso, já estava cansado de lançar receitas e, coloquei só uma passada para testar, porém, nesse caso é importante lançar as despesas com data de início passada também (no formato YYYY-MM), e ele vai gerar esses gráficos em outra tela (De Despesas Passadas) com as receitas consolidadas nos últimos 12 meses. Vou mandar o print, mas nesse caso não tem muita coisa, porque só lancei 1 receita passada pra testar mesmo:

image.png

Para quem quiser testar, estou anexando os módulos aqui.

Segue link de download: https://id7.com.br/files/receitas_e_despesas_whmcs.zip

UPDATE: Mandei versão nova com TOTAL no final da tabela.

As instruções de instalação:

Receitas e Despesas (Consolidadas e Futuras) para WHMCS.
Autor: Antonio Ayres - antonio@id7.com.br

COMO INSTALAR:
1 - Suba os arquivos para as respectivas pastas no servidor (modules/addons). A estrutura deve ficar assim:

/modules
  /addons
     /receitas_despesas_consolidadas
        logo.png
        receitas_despesas_consolidadas.php
        whmcs.json
     /receitas_despesas_futuras
        logo.png
        receitas_despesas_futuras.php
        whmcs.json

2 - No WHMCS, vá nas configurações em Aplicativos e Integrações
3 - Na categoria FINANÇA, você encontrará 2 módulos: "Receitas e Despesas Consolidadas" e "Receitas e Despesas Futuras" Ou se preferir use a busca e pesquise por "Receitas e Despesas"
4 - Ative primeiro o módulo Receitas e Despesas Futuras.
5 - Na tela de Configurações do Módulo (deve aparecer automaticamente após ativar, mas caso não apareça, vá em Configurações > Opções > Módulos Addon) e no módulo de Receitas e Despesas Futuras ativo, clique em Configurar. Escolha os grupos que terão permissão para acessar o módulo. Escolha pelo menos o Full Administrator e, se desejar, outros, e salve.
6 - Refaça os passos 2 a 5 com o segundo Módulo (Receitas e Despesas Consolidadas).
7 - Se tiver feito tudo corretamente, você verá 2 submenus novos no menu "Complementos"

Editado por AntonioA


Participe da conversa

Você pode postar agora e se cadastrar mais tarde. Se você tem uma conta, faça o login para postar com sua conta.
Nota: Sua postagem exigirá aprovação do moderador antes de ficar visível.

Visitante
Infelizmente, seu conteúdo contém termos que não são permitimos. Edite seu conteúdo para remover as palavras destacadas abaixo.
Responder

Quem Está Navegando 0

  • Nenhum usuário registrado visualizando esta página.

Informação Importante

Concorda com os nossos termos?

Configure browser push notifications

Chrome (Android)
  1. Tap the lock icon next to the address bar.
  2. Tap Permissions → Notifications.
  3. Adjust your preference.
Chrome (Desktop)
  1. Click the padlock icon in the address bar.
  2. Select Site settings.
  3. Find Notifications and adjust your preference.